WebFifth disease is a viral illness that causes a bright red rash on the cheeks. The rash can then spread to the body, arms, and legs. The rash lasts 2 to 4 days. Other symptoms can include runny nose, sore throat, and low fever. Fifth disease is spread from one child to another through direct contact with fluid from the nose and throat. They are members of the Picornaviridae family; small, icosahedral, single-stranded, positive-sense RNA viruses. The most well known of the enteroviruses is the poliovirus (PV) but this has mostly been eradicated.
